Unlocking Efficiency: 5 Unexpected Tools to Enhance Your Study Sessions
Studying effectively can often feel like a daunting task, but with the right tools, you can unlock efficiency and enhance your study sessions beyond traditional methods. Here are five unexpected tools that can significantly improve your focus and productivity:
- Ambient Sound Apps: Utilizing soundscapes or white noise can create an environment conducive to concentration. Apps like Noisli or A Soft Murmur allow you to mix sounds tailored to your preference, helping you to maintain focus during lengthy study periods.
- Digital Flashcards: While flashcards are a staple in studying, platforms like Quizlet take them to the next level. You can create, share, and access a vast library of flashcards on various subjects, turning rote memorization into an engaging activity.
- Pomodoro Timers: The Pomodoro Technique, which focuses on breaking work into short, timed intervals, can be enhanced with apps like Forest. Not only does it help manage time, but it also encourages breaks that improve retention and minimize burnout.
- Mind Mapping Software: Tools like MindMeister can help visualize complex topics, making it easier to see connections and enhance understanding. This approach fosters creative thinking and can lead to better recall during exams.
- Study Groups Online: Platforms like Discord or Slack can facilitate study groups regardless of location. Collaboration and discussion can provide insights that solo studying often lacks, making the process more interactive and less isolating.
